What You Will Do
  • Reconcile daily financial transactions and prepare reports
  • Ensure accuracy in guest billing and resolve discrepancies
  • Perform overnight audit procedures and system balancing
  • Assist with guest check‑ins and check‑outs during overnight hours
  • Respond to guest inquiries and requests with professionalism and care
  • Maintain accurate records and follow hotel procedures
  • Support a safe and secure environment during the night shift
What We Are Looking For
  • Reliable and able to work overnight shifts
  • Detail oriented with strong organizational and problem‑solving skills
  • Strong communicators with a guest‑first mindset
  • Professional and able to work independently
  • Positive, respectful, and team oriented
Preferred Experience
  • At least 2 years of hotel or front desk experience
  • Familiarity with hotel management systems and reporting tools
Certifications Requirement

Must obtain a valid Alcohol Server Certification within 30 days of hire.

Must maintain all required certifications in accordance with state and company guidelines.

Physical Requirements (Essential Job Functions)
  • Stand and walk for extended periods up to 8 hours per shift
  • Use computers and office equipment for extended periods
  • Occasionally lift, carry, or move items such as supplies or luggage
  • Maintain focus and attention to detail throughout overnight shifts
